1,000 Buddhas
Wanted: Buddha. 1,000 times. Photography site Lens Culture has put out a global call for images of the roly-poly, sacred figure. Already, the collections boasts images of the deity posing in a shop window in Amsterdam and sitting on a table in New York. He towers over a garden in Thailand; hides in a collection of garden clippings in Berkeley, CA; and casts his legendary profile against a cloudy Japanese sky. Here, he appears in a colorful poster in a Beijing market; there, he manifests in the dark lines tattooed on a man's forearm. Sometimes, he looks angry, like the "stern Buddha" captured by Edward Galligan in "a small Buddhist temple in the hills of Coxsackie, NY." One picture reveals the "world's largest seated outdoor Buddha" on Lantau Island in Hong Kong. Lens Culture ventures that the project "may well generate good karma for everyone involved, viewers and contributors, alike." 1,000 times over.
